Campfire BLT

camping food
Campfire BLT. Photo Credit: Champagne Tastes.

This BLT is ready in 20 minutes and can be cooked on a camp stove or campfire.

Make sure to pack the tomato slices and lettuce separately to avoid soggy sandwiches.

Grilled BBQ Chicken Breasts

camping food
Grilled BBQ Chicken Breasts. Photo Credit: The Short Order Cook.

These grilled chicken breasts are easy to make, filling, and exactly what you want after a long day outside.

You only need three simple ingredients to make this dish! Make sure to dry the chicken before applying the rub so it sticks better.
